What local pests are most common in Cambridge?

Common pests in this area include Norway rats, house mice, German and American cockroaches, and various spiders like black widows and brown recluses. Knowing what we're dealing with locally lets us tailor our pest control services to what's actually showing up in your home.

What are the warning signs that I need pest control services?

Warning signs include visible pests, droppings, gnaw marks, and structural damage. If you're spotting any of these, it's time to call us for pest control services before the problem gets worse.

How can I prevent pest problems from recurring after pest control?

Regular maintenance is the real key here. Keep your property clean, seal up entry points, and manage moisture levels — that'll go a long way toward keeping pests from coming back. We can provide ongoing monitoring and recommendations.

When does pest control repair versus replacement make more sense in Cambridge?

Spot treatment works fine if you've got a single nesting site pinned down. You're looking at a full property treatment when multiple species show up, the infestation's come back after two or more treatments, or there are structural conditions on the property that keep making things worse.
